Gilded Age

Back

A period in the late 19th century known for rapid economic growth and ostentatious displays of wealth, but also marked by political corruption and social inequality.

Labor Union

Back

An organization of workers formed to protect and advance their rights and interests; often involved in negotiating wages and working conditions.

Political Machines

Back

Political organizations in the late 19th and early 20th centuries that controlled election results by awarding jobs and other favors in exchange for votes.

Progressive Era

Back

A period of social activism and political reform in the United States from the 1890s to the 1920s, aimed at eliminating problems caused by industrialization, urbanization, immigration, and political corruption.

Progressivism

Back

A political and social-reform movement that brought major changes to American politics and government during the early 20th century.

Robber Barons

Back

A term used to describe powerful 19th-century industrialists who were viewed as having used questionable practices to amass their wealth.

Social Reforms

Back

Efforts aimed at improving society by addressing issues such as poverty, education, and public health.
